Water damage can occur in various ways, from a burst pipe to pure disasters corresponding to floods. Regardless of the cause, the aftermath typically consists of the unwelcome visitor of mold development after water damage.


Mold thrives in damp environments, and when moisture ranges are constantly elevated as a result of water damage, the circumstances become perfect for mold spores. These spores are everywhere, often lying dormant until they discover the proper situations to flourish.


Once water seeps into walls, floors, or ceilings, the danger of mold growth increases significantly. Mold can start to develop inside 24 to 48 hours after water publicity. This fast escalation makes immediate action essential after any sort of water damage.

The forms of mold that may develop after water damage vary extensively. Some are comparatively innocent, however others can pose severe well being risks. Common varieties embrace Cladosporium, Penicillium, and Stachybotrys, also known as black mold. Black mold is particularly notorious and is usually related to extreme allergic reactions and respiratory issues.


Identifying mold development can generally be easy. A visible inspection may reveal discoloration or fuzzy patches on surfaces. An unpleasant, musty odor typically accompanies these visible signs. In some circumstances, however, mold can develop hidden behind walls or under flooring, making it much less detectable until it turns into a critical issue.


To prevent mold growth after water damage, quick action is crucial. The first step entails totally drying the affected area. Adequate air flow, dehumidifiers, and fans might help accelerate the drying process. The objective is to reduce back humidity levels to under 60 %.


In addition to drying, cleaning and disinfecting surfaces is vital. Using appropriate cleansing agents might help get rid of mold spores which may be already present. However, it's essential to wear protective gear similar to masks and gloves to avoid inhalation and pores and skin exposure through the cleanup.

If the mold has already established itself, it may be necessary to remove and exchange porous supplies corresponding to drywall or carpets. These materials can take up moisture, which makes them vulnerable to mold colonization. Once mold has settled into porous surfaces, simple cleansing will not be enough.


Professional remediation services could also be required for extensive water damage situations. These consultants are trained to assess the extent of mold contamination and may employ efficient removing techniques. They also have entry to specialised equipment and cleansing brokers that may not be available for common use.


Long-term prevention can be achieved by controlling moisture ranges within the house. This entails common inspections of plumbing systems and roofs for leaks. Additionally, ensuring proper drainage across the basis can help maintain water from accumulating.

Homeowners must also consider investing in water detection techniques. These devices can monitor humidity levels and alert homeowners to leaks earlier than they escalate into major water damage situations.


Education on the indications of water damage is crucial for early detection. Signs may embody water stains on ceilings or partitions and peeling paint or wallpaper. Timely attention to those signs can reduce the danger of mold growth after water damage.

It’s additionally crucial to take care of proper indoor air quality to prevent mold reoccurrence. This consists of using air purifiers outfitted with HEPA filters, maintaining acceptable air flow in bogs and kitchens, and avoiding extreme indoor humidity.


Failing to handle mold points not only impacts the aesthetic and structural integrity of a property but can also result in vital health issues for occupants. Individuals with respiratory points, allergy symptoms, or weakened immune methods are particularly susceptible to mold publicity.

    What causes mold growth after water damage?



Mold growth occurs when supplies become wet and stay moist for more than 24-48 hours. Organic materials, similar to wooden, drywall, and insulation, serve as food sources for mold, making them significantly vulnerable after water damage.

Can I take away mold myself, or should I hire a professional?


Small areas of mold (less than 10 sq. feet) can usually be cleaned with cleaning soap and water or a combination of vinegar and water. However, for larger infestations, hiring a professional mold remediation service is advisable to ensure full removal and safety.

Is mold removal assured after remediation?


While professional mold remediation significantly reduces mold levels, it is challenging to guarantee full removing. Ongoing monitoring and maintenance of humidity levels are important to forestall recurrence.

Does homeowners insurance cover mold damage?

Coverage for mold damage varies by coverage and provider. Typically, householders insurance coverage covers mold if it results from a covered peril, such as sudden water damage. However, it often excludes mold ensuing from long-term neglect or poor maintenance.
